Radio will not tune in
Hello all, the radio in my 96 850 turbo wagon will not tune into a specific station it will pick up stations at random. This all started after replacing the battery. Punched in the code and radio stations started playing at random but will not change with the dial. Anyone heard of this or did my radio just get fried somehow?

RE: Radio will not tune in
It is not antenna or booster -the electronic tuner is changing the stations, antenna/booster only supply signal that is then amplified, and if the signal is weak or there is no signal, the tuner should stay at the chosen frequency, and you'd hear noise/static, but it should not go to another frequency.
I'd try to turn the raio OFF, disconnect the battery or the radio itself, wait 10-15 min., re-connect and try again to turn it On - meybe it will reset it.
